Histamin what is their purpose in the immune system

Respuesta :

devongonzales75 devongonzales75
  • 02-11-2017
  well it increases the permeability of the capillaries to white blood cells and some proteins, to allow them to engage pathogens in the infected tissues... i hope this is what you were looking for
